ExpressionServices.TryConvert<TResult> Methode
Definitie
Belangrijk
Bepaalde informatie heeft betrekking op een voorlopige productversie die aanzienlijk kan worden gewijzigd voordat deze wordt uitgebracht. Microsoft biedt geen enkele expliciete of impliciete garanties met betrekking tot de informatie die hier wordt verstrekt.
Converteert een omgevingsbewuste werkstroomexpressie naar een activiteitsstructuur.
public:
generic <typename TResult>
static bool TryConvert(System::Linq::Expressions::Expression<Func<System::Activities::ActivityContext ^, TResult> ^> ^ expression, [Runtime::InteropServices::Out] System::Activities::Activity<TResult> ^ % result);
public static bool TryConvert<TResult>(System.Linq.Expressions.Expression<Func<System.Activities.ActivityContext,TResult>> expression, out System.Activities.Activity<TResult> result);
static member TryConvert : System.Linq.Expressions.Expression<Func<System.Activities.ActivityContext, 'Result>> * Activity -> bool
Public Shared Function TryConvert(Of TResult) (expression As Expression(Of Func(Of ActivityContext, TResult)), ByRef result As Activity(Of TResult)) As Boolean
Type parameters
- TResult
Het type waar de expressie naar wordt geconverteerd.
Parameters
- expression
- Expression<Func<ActivityContext,TResult>>
De expressie die wordt geconverteerd.
- result
- Activity<TResult>
De geconverteerde expressie.
Retouren
true als de expressie kan worden geconverteerd; anders, false.
Opmerkingen
De conversiemethoden in ExpressionServices zijn ontworpen om te werken met variabelen en constanten die in de werkstroom zijn gedefinieerd of die via argumenten in de werkstroom worden doorgegeven.